Navarre is a village located in Stark County, Ohio. Navarre has a 2025 population of 1,785. Navarre is currently declining at a rate of -0.56% annually and its population has decreased by -2.72%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 1,835 in 2020.

The average household income in Navarre is $78,154 with a poverty rate of 7.96%.The median age in Navarre is 49.7 years: 46 years for males, and 50.9 years for females.

Navarre's average per capita income is $41,766. Household income levels show a median of $56,715. The poverty rate stands at 7.96%.

Families: A family includes the owner or renter of the home along with everyone related to them - whether through birth, marriage, or adoption. This includes relatives like spouses, children, parents, siblings, grandparents, and any other family members.
Households: A household includes all the people who occupy a housing unit (such as a house or apartment) as their usual place of residence.
Non Families: A nonfamily household is either someone living alone or when the owner/renter lives with people they aren't related to, like roommates.
